Output 31b68180ae01931d0fcbd5ecce8fad4d7cb83b28535cd4f9a35600f74aa47d1a:13

value
4622354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d78132dd4704e181baa543fc7151445a61957ed OP_EQUAL
address
35qSB8Moj7j9axNWzboH2QZPEMPKx97Z7R
transaction
31b68180ae01931d0fcbd5ecce8fad4d7cb83b28535cd4f9a35600f74aa47d1a
spent
true